Generally organisms respond to abiotic factors four ways. In bacteria, fungi and algae, thick walled spores are formed to overcome unfavourable conditions. Which type of response is it in this case?

  1. A

    Regulate

  2. B

    Suspend

  3. C

    Conform

  4. D

    Migrate

    Solution:

    In bacteria, fungi and lower plants, various kinds of thick-walled spores are formed which help them to survive unfavourable conditions – these germinate on availability of suitable environment. This is referred to as ‘suspend’.
